Pixel Poetry starring Jimmy Barnett, Adam Sessler, Warren Spector, Ajay Chadha has a Not Rated rating, a runtime of about 1 hr 10 min, and a scheduled release date of August 15th, 2014.

It received a user score of 70/100 on TMDb, which compiled reviews from 5 top users.

Curious about the story behind it? Here's the plot: "Are videogames art? Do they influence violent behavior? What effect have they had on society? How would you describe videogames to Leonardo da Vinci? These are always great questions to start a conversation. Pixel Poetry is a documentary film about progressive creative culture as it has been championed by one of its greatest advocates - videogames. Using popular debates that have long surrounded videogames as a catalyst for this, the film will analyze the misunderstood notions and arguments in art and technological advancement to bring a new perspective to a compelling discussion about the evolution of its meaning." .
